Cardano switched on its first live Inter-Blockchain Communication connection this month, linking to Injective. The channel is explicitly labeled experimental, and it is running on testnet only. None of that is a footnote. All three of those facts — IBC, Injective, testnet — are why this is worth thinking about carefully instead of treating it as a launch.
The technical distinction matters first. Cardano's existing cross-chain footprint, such as it is, has been built almost entirely on trusted bridges: third-party operators who attest to events on the other side of the connection, usually with multisig custody and varying degrees of slashing or insurance layered on top. IBC works differently. It verifies the counterparty chain's consensus state directly, header by header, the way a Cosmos hub already does for the chains in its zone. There is no custodian in the loop to compromise, because there is no custodian. The trust assumption shifts from "this operator behaves" to "this chain's consensus doesn't break." That is a meaningfully different security model, and it is the model Cardano has now demonstrated, in working code, against an external chain.
This is not Cardano joining Cosmos. IBC was originally designed inside the Cosmos stack, but the protocol itself is chain-agnostic — any chain that can produce verifiable consensus headers can in principle run it. Cardano implementing IBC is closer to Ethereum's adoption of ERC-20 standards than it is to a corporate alliance. The technical question becomes: did the Cardano team actually pull it off, and does it work as advertised? Per a Cexplorer report from August 14, the answer is "yes, on testnet, between two known participants." That is more than Cardano had a month ago, and less than a production deployment.
Why Injective matters as the counterparty. Injective is not a random pick. It is a Cosmos-zone chain optimized for derivatives and on-chain order books, with deep native IBC connectivity to the broader Cosmos ecosystem — which means a Cardano↔Injective channel is, in practice, a Cardano↔Injective↔most-of-Cosmos channel once routing matures. That changes what kind of flow could plausibly show up. ADA could in principle land on an Injective perpetual market, or on a Cosmos-native DEX, without a wrapped-asset intermediary holding the funds. For Cardano builders, the more interesting direction is the other way: Cosmos-side collateral and liquidity could reach Cardano's DeFi layer through the same channel. Whether any of that actually happens depends on what gets built on top of the connection, which is the part nobody has answered yet.
The testnet label is the load-bearing detail. Testnet means three things at once: the protocol works in controlled conditions, it has not been hardened against adversarial pressure at scale, and no real economic value is moving through it. Conflating this with a mainnet launch — the way some of the breathless cross-chain coverage tends to — would be a mistake. What it actually represents is that the implementation has cleared the engineering milestone where two independent consensus systems can pass packets between each other and decode them correctly. That is the hard part of IBC to get right, and the part most bridge designs skip by handing custody to a multisig. If Cardano's IBC implementation survives adversarial fuzzing, governance review, and a public audit cycle on its way to mainnet, the testnet channel is the foundation that makes that possible.
What to watch from here. Three things will tell us whether this is a real strategic shift or a research demo that ages quietly. First, whether a second counterparty chain shows up — a single IBC channel is a proof of concept, not an interop strategy, and the value of IBC scales with the number of zones reachable through it. Second, whether the implementation goes through a Cardano governance cycle with adversarial review before any mainnet flag day, the way the Van Rossem hard fork did, or whether it ships via a more conventional core-infrastructure path. Third, what actually gets built on top. A working IBC channel with no consumer dApp is engineering theater. The first protocol that routes meaningful volume through it — a Cosmos-side collateral wrapper on Cardano, an ADA perpetual on Injective, a treasury rebalance for some multi-chain fund — is what turns this from a milestone into a fact about Cardano's economic surface area.
None of that is happening today. What is happening is that Cardano has, for the first time, a cryptographic bridge to another chain that does not require trusting a bridge operator. The chain chose a standard that already has years of production hardening behind it, picked a counterparty that maximizes the reachable surface area, and did it on testnet where the failure modes are recoverable. That sequence of choices is correct. The next question — whether anything real starts flowing through it — is the one that actually matters, and it will not be answered by announcements.
